Dog bite claims can be brought under two causes of action. One cause of action is called "strict liability". Strict liability refers to an owner's responsibility over his or her dog. In Arizona, dogs are not allowed one "free bite"―when a dog bites someone, the owner is responsible. A strict liability claim against a dog owner must be filed within one year.
Negligence refers to a property owner's negligence in controlling a dog that has previously bitten. A dog with a prior bite is said to have a vicious propensity. The plaintiff may be entitled to punitive damages. Claims must be filed within two years.
